Introducing Devblog by Hashnode. Highly customizable and optimized for developers. This document describes the procedure for building the XNU kernel on Mac OS X 10. XNU is an acronym for XNU is Not Unix.
Apple has confirmed patching multiple XNU kernel vulnerabilities in MacOS. One of these bugs also affected iOS devices, causing the target . Apple finally releassed the XNU source code for macOS Mojave. Does the XNU kernel have a KVM port in progress already? I know KVM was ported to the illumos kernel.
How feasible is to have the same . Warum Linux als Kernel ein Nachteil wäre. The macOS kernel is officially known as XNU. Essential information for programming in the OS X kernel.
Includes a high-level overview. References are provided for XNU. The BSD subsystem is part of the kernel and so are . Apple macOS XNU Kernel - Memory Disclosure due to bug in Kernel API for Detecting Kernel Memory Disclosures . Presumably, the file is opened and mapped during loading of the host executable , which has it listed as a dependency directly or indirectly via . Debugging the XNU Kernel with IDA Pro.
OS und macOS: Apple veröffentlicht Kernel-Quellcode. Alle Apple-Betriebssystemene basieren auf dem XNU - Kernel. Er besteht aus dem XNU - Kernel und einigen grundlegenden Systemframeworks. Dazu zählen OpenCL, Verzeichnisdienste, . Darwin ist der Kern von Mac OS X. XNU ) source has been released.
XNU on supported Apple hardware. The Mac OS X kernel is called xnu. In the simplest sense, xnu could be viewed as having a Mach-based core, a BSD-based operating system personality, and . XNU may also be referred to as the OS X kernel or iOS kernel. This allows developers to easily find and add code. This page is about the XNU kernel.
Author of several XNU Kernel -related CVEs and exploits. For those of you that already have . I have written a proof-of-concept exploit which can . Being able to debugging the XNU kernel is one of basic skill of my work. So I decided to wrapup a post to summarize . It does not cover building other parts of . A locking bug in the XNU virtual memory subsystem allowed.
The XNU kernel is large and complex, and a full architectural description is beyond the scope of this book (there are other books that fill this need), but we will, . Apples Betriebssysteme mögen in weiten Teilen proprietäre Software sein, im Kern steckt aber Open Source. Betroffen hiervon ist die Funktion hashes der Komponente XNU Kernel. Durch Manipulation mit einer unbekannten Eingabe kann eine Denial . MachX- Kernel Bevor ich ein Projekt anstrebe, das zum Scheitern verurteilt ist, möchte ich die Dinge klarstellen, damit sie nicht . Apple has released the source code of the XNU kernel used in its macOS and iOS operating systems on GitHub for developers to build upon or . Vulnerability Discovery First I downloaded the latest source code release of the XNU kernel ,and then I searched for a vulnerability in the following way: . Apple has silently released ARM-ready source code for the XNU kernels found in iOS and macOS, marking a first for iOS, and possibly showing . The xnu kernel provides a function for this.
Ich ver herauszufinden, wie Sie eine Liste und Dokumentation der Systemaufrufe erhalten, die im XNU - Kernel unter OSX verfügbar sind. The logic of this function fails to correctly .
Keine Kommentare:
Kommentar veröffentlichen
Hinweis: Nur ein Mitglied dieses Blogs kann Kommentare posten.